Abstract

A multiple power conversion system includes a plurality of first to n-th unit power converters. DC positive sides of the plurality of unit power converters are connected to one another, DC negative sides of the plurality of unit power converters are connected to one another, and n is an integer of two or more. The multiple power conversion system further includes a detector to detect a current flowing through the DC positive side or the DC negative side of a corresponding one of (n−1) or more of the plurality of unit power converters. The multiple power conversion system that can detect a circulating current with a smaller number of current sensors.

Claims (21)

1. A multiple power conversion system comprising:

a plurality of unit power converters, wherein

each of the plurality of unit power converters includes a DC neutral point which is a connection point of two DC capacitors provided between a DC positive side and a DC negative side, and a DC side current sensor which detects a current flowing through the DC neutral point,

the DC positive side of each unit power converters is connected to a first parallel connection point provided on a DC side,

the DC negative side of each unit power converters is connected to a second parallel connection point provided on a DC side, and

the DC neutral point of each unit power converters is connected to a third parallel connection point provided on a DC side,

the multiple power conversion system comprising:

a DC side integrated current sensor that is disposed between the first parallel connection point and a power supply and detects a current on a DC positive side flowing through the first parallel connection point; and

a control device for controlling each unit power converters, wherein

the DC side current sensor is configured to detect current flowing through a DC neutral point of a target unit power converter among the plurality of unit power converters, and

the control device configured to:

calculate a nonuniform amount of the current flowing through each of the plurality of unit power converters based on detected values of the DC side current sensor and a DC side integration current sensor; and

specify a unit power converter in which a short circuit failure has occurred among the plurality of unit power converters based on the current nonuniform amounts.

2.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 1 , further comprising the control device configured to perform protective operation of the plurality of unit power converters when the current nonuniform amounts is greater than a threshold.

3.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 2 , wherein the control device turns off a switching element for at least one phase included in at least one of the plurality of unit power converters.

4.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 2 , wherein

each of the plurality of unit power converters includes a plurality of switches provided on at least two of the DC positive side, the DC negative side, and the DC neutral point, and

the control device turns off the plurality of switches in a unit power converter in failure based on detected values of the current sensors.

5.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 1 , further comprising the control device configured to transmit, to each of the plurality of unit power converters, a same gate signal or a gate signal generated from a same voltage instruction value.

6.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of unit power converters are configured to be a three phase or single-phase.

7. The multiple power conversion system according to claim 1 , wherein the control device configured to specify a unit power converter having the greatest nonuniform amount among the plurality of unit power converters as a unit power converter in which a short circuit failure has occurred.
